This travel journal is a shortened version of the Dutch travel journal, maybe someday if
we have more time we will translate the whole journal. Here you can read day by day what we
did during our trip to China Day 1 - Sunday January 2, 2005 Finally, we are leaving for China. At 7 pm our plane left for Beijing. Day 2 - Monday January 3, 2005 At 11.30 am we arrived in Beijing. Now it's waiting for our flight to Hangzhou. We finally arrived at 6 pm in Hangzhou.
GOTCHA day or in our case JINTE day. After a long waiting - the children should come at 2 pm - they finally brought Jinte at 4.30 pm to our hotel room. Day 4 - Wednesday January 5, 2005 Paper day. At 9 am to Civil Affairs to make the adoption official. In the afternoon some formalilties at a local police office to get a passport. Day 5 - Thursday January 6, 2005 Today we visited the orphanage in Longyou, at 9 am we left for about a 3 hour drive and just got back in the hotel at 8 pm.
After visiting the notary it was a touristic day. First a boat trip at the West Lake, after that we went to the Mausoleum of General Yue Fei. Day 7 - Saturday January 8, 2005 Another touristic day. In the morning we visited the Six Harmonies Pagoda with its beautiful view over the Qiantang River and the city, in the afternoon we went to Fei Lai Feng and Ling Yin Temple. All in all a tiring day climbing all that stairs.
A day off, we did some shopping, took a walk and start packing. This is our last day in Hangzhou. Day 9 - Monday January 10, 2005 We left our hotel at 11.30 am. After a 2 hour flight we arrived in Beijing. Day 10 - Tuesday January 11, 2005 Another day off. Our hotel is between Tian'anmen square and the Silk market. We spent most of the day at the Silk Market.
Our first touristic day in Beijing. Today we visited the Great Wall. Very impressive but also very very cold. In the afternoon again to the silk market. Day 12 - Thursday January 13, 2005 Another touristic day. A visit to the Summerpalace. In the afternoon the most of the group took some rest. After one and a half week the most of us get a little tired.
A touristic day again. A visit to the Forbidden City. Also we visited Tian'anmen square and the Mausoleum of Mao. again a lot of walking and climbing. Day 14 - Saturday January 15, 2005 Our last day in China. We did not much this day, some shopping -read silkmarket- and packing for the big trip home Day 15 - Sunday January 16, 2005 Finally..... We left Beijing at 2 pm to arrive in the Netherlands at 5 pm. ......Home |
